PPROF 调试信息泄露漏洞的防范与应对
在现代软件开发过程中,性能分析工具如 PPROF
成为了开发者不可或缺的利器,随着安全威胁的不断演变,PPROF
的调试信息泄露问题成为了开发者和安全专家关注的重点,本文将深入探讨这一漏洞及其影响,并提供一些防范措施。
PPROF 简介
PPROF
(Profiling and Performance Analysis Tool)是一个用于收集和分析应用程序执行性能数据的专业工具,它通过跟踪程序运行时的数据流,帮助开发者理解程序的执行效率、瓶颈以及资源使用情况等关键信息,尽管 PPROF
在提升应用性能方面有着显著的效果,但其调试信息的泄露也带来了严重的安全隐患。
调试信息泄露漏洞的影响
-
数据敏感性暴露:当调试信息被泄露后,攻击者可以获取到应用程序内部的重要数据,这包括但不限于用户输入、配置文件、数据库连接字符串等敏感信息。
-
安全风险增加:一旦这些信息落入不法之徒手中,可能导致身份盗用、数据泄露甚至更严重的网络攻击事件。
-
系统稳定性受损:如果调试信息泄露导致了系统崩溃或不稳定表现,可能会严重影响用户的正常使用体验。
-
法律合规问题:对于涉及到个人隐私保护的应用程序来说,泄漏调试信息还可能引发法律诉讼和监管处罚。
防范措施
-
限制权限访问:确保只有授权人员才能查看调试信息,可以通过角色管理机制实现对不同级别的权限控制。
-
加密存储:对于包含敏感信息的文件,应采用加密技术进行存储,防止未经授权的解密访问。
-
定期备份:设置定期备份策略,以防万一发生信息泄露事故,能够及时恢复至未受影响的状态。
-
教育与培训:加强对开发团队的安全意识培训,提醒他们不要在未经允许的情况下向外部泄露调试信息。
-
监控与审计:建立完善的监控体系和审计流程,及时发现并处理可能存在的调试信息泄露风险。
虽然 PPROF
的调试信息泄露漏洞给软件安全带来了挑战,但在采取适当防护措施的前提下,我们完全有能力避免这种潜在的风险,开发者和安全专家需要共同努力,确保软件产品的稳定性和安全性得到双重保障。